repositories
/
benchmarks-js.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
feat: add object hashing benchmarking
[benchmarks-js.git]
/
deep-merge-object.mjs
diff --git
a/deep-merge-object.mjs
b/deep-merge-object.mjs
index 50cc13cb4cbe60341f815d6310fab4dacaac0b01..a33dc2160d1b3547f89d0d54adf63d585861bfb8 100644
(file)
--- a/
deep-merge-object.mjs
+++ b/
deep-merge-object.mjs
@@
-15,13
+15,13
@@
group(
} keys, object with ${Object.keys(objectToMerge).length} keys`,
() => {
bench('lodash merge', (obj = object) => {
} keys, object with ${Object.keys(objectToMerge).length} keys`,
() => {
bench('lodash merge', (obj = object) => {
-
const objMerged =
_.merge(obj, objectToMerge)
+ _.merge(obj, objectToMerge)
})
bench('rambda mergeDeepRight', (obj = object) => {
})
bench('rambda mergeDeepRight', (obj = object) => {
-
const objMerged =
mergeDeepRight(obj, objectToMerge)
+ mergeDeepRight(obj, objectToMerge)
})
bench('deepmerge', (obj = object) => {
})
bench('deepmerge', (obj = object) => {
-
const objMerged =
deepMerge(obj, objectToMerge)
+ deepMerge(obj, objectToMerge)
})
}
)
})
}
)